Rock mass classification is an extremely powerful and useful tool in rock engineering, and this lecture gives an introduction to rock mass classification. It puts a number to the quality of a rock mass, and numbers facilitate the application of engineering in rock masses. Several rock mass classification systems are described in the lecture, as well as examples of applications of classification in the evaluation of stability of excavations, estimation of rock support requirements, and determination of rock mass deformation and strength parameters. The lecture will help new users to become proficient in the application of rock mass classifications.

This lecture is presented by Dick Stacey,
Emeritus Professor, University of the Witwatersrand, Johannesburg
